Koninklijke KPN N.V. (KKPNF)
OTCMKTS · Delayed Price · Currency is USD
5.52
+0.13 (2.41%)
At close: Feb 11, 2026

Koninklijke KPN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
21,14217,85714,14313,75212,24612,803
Market Cap Growth
51.13%26.26%2.84%12.30%-4.35%0.30%
Enterprise Value
29,05726,17320,39820,69619,12219,482
Last Close Price
5.524.683.463.222.942.95
PE Ratio
21.0617.7917.1215.4815.448.81
PS Ratio
3.092.612.442.292.162.14
PB Ratio
5.064.273.873.493.143.49
P/TBV Ratio
37.0531.2924.5316.6114.9650.71
P/FCF Ratio
13.9411.7710.869.959.349.88
P/OCF Ratio
7.806.596.035.555.245.29
EV/Sales Ratio
4.203.823.523.443.373.25
EV/EBITDA Ratio
8.938.588.708.478.198.06
EV/EBIT Ratio
17.5315.8313.9713.7214.2815.82
EV/FCF Ratio
19.1517.2515.6614.9714.5815.04
Debt / Equity Ratio
1.991.992.051.981.822.38
Debt / EBITDA Ratio
2.572.573.033.022.893.41
Debt / FCF Ratio
5.485.485.775.645.436.74
Asset Turnover
0.460.460.450.450.430.43
Inventory Turnover
--58.8454.6757.5458.95
Quick Ratio
0.200.200.540.690.730.78
Current Ratio
0.640.640.600.760.830.84
Return on Equity (ROE)
24.10%24.10%23.90%23.35%22.23%43.88%
Return on Assets (ROA)
6.97%6.97%7.11%7.05%6.34%5.46%
Return on Invested Capital (ROIC)
10.87%11.11%11.14%10.81%9.87%8.90%
Return on Capital Employed (ROCE)
13.30%13.30%14.10%13.40%12.20%10.30%
Earnings Yield
4.75%5.62%6.21%6.78%6.63%11.44%
FCF Yield
7.18%8.49%9.21%10.05%10.71%10.12%
Dividend Yield
3.68%4.57%5.09%5.14%5.20%5.24%
Payout Ratio
85.85%85.85%81.84%74.29%77.37%43.79%
Buyback Yield / Dilution
-4.38%-4.38%1.90%2.70%2.32%0.44%
Total Shareholder Return
-0.70%0.18%7.00%7.85%7.51%5.68%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.